Ordinals
beta
Address 3Cef8w1MidNAsojZew1v4DvdFeiWcwffg9
sat balance
8998
outputs
f8c10b5de4cf64062b85bf7e88cba15f8bdc3fe1e72b8695784104fe62e096d6:0
6fa3e3ad97374b683e10d006ceaf9b1ca2d480d8affb72a103f166e41681b7de:0